Celebrating Past Scholarships: AWMF takes pride in bringing up the next generation through scholarship programs. This past year, AWMF in partnership with Hallmark, awarded the Make Her Mark scholarship to Raha Amirfazli of New York University. AWMF also granted the 2025 AWM Foundation/NCTA – The Internet & Television Association Scholarship to Dayana Matasheva, a Columbia University School of the Arts MFA student.

In addition, eight AWM Foundation Student Fellows had the opportunity to attend the Gracies Leadership Awards in New York, gaining valuable exposure and connection to media industry leaders. About the Alliance for Women in Media Foundation (AWMF): In 1960, the Alliance for Women in Media became the first professional broadcasting organization to establish an educational foundation. The AWMF supports and promotes educational programs, charitable activities and scholarships to benefit the public and media industry. The Foundation also produces nationally acclaimed recognition programs, including the Gracie Awards®, honoring exemplary programming created by, for or about women and individual achievement.
